Muse Painbar Hopes To Try New Things At Dedham Location
The popular paintbar is coming to Dedham.

DEDHAM, MA — Muse Paintbar is going to try something new when they open their Dedham location.
Stan Finch, the founder of the establishment, told the selectmen last week that they are going to use their new Legacy Place location to test custom cocktails, along with mixed drinks. All other Muse Paintbars have only served beer and wine, he said.
Muse, known for their painting classes, was in front of the board for a liquor license transfer from Chili's. Customers can take paint classes while enjoying food and drinks and can paint on a variety of surfaces from a standard 16x20 canvass to a mason jar and street sigh.

Due to a technicality about the listed manager, the board was unable to award the license and voted to continue the hearing until July 13, where they are expected to vote on a request with the permanent manager of record listed. Board members were impressed with the chain.
"I've heard great things about the store. I know a lot of people are very interested. We have a process and formality to go through and we'll be here in July," Selectman Brendan Keogh said.

No opening date was announced at the meeting or is listed on the Legacy Place website.
